Welcome to La Palma.

We will accompany you to your accommodation in the heart of the island, where nature and silence set the pace.

This 7-day/6-night expedition will begin with a welcome briefing where we will explain the day-to-day details of your trip and an initial workshop on mobile phone photography so that you can get the most out of your experience in La Palma. You will also learn how to improve your photos and editing skills.

During the expedition, we will take you in search of the best images of La Palma's landscapes. We know the terrain and will take you to the perfect place at the right time; you will explore laurel forests, lava flows, impressive viewpoints, and the best natural landscapes at a leisurely pace, without crowds. We want your images to show the true beauty of this Biosphere Reserve. An adventure that combines culture, traditions, and landscapes.

Recap of experiences and transfer to the airport. The expedition ends here, but the way you see the world will have changed.

La Palma is a living territory, shaped by volcanoes, clouds that move like inland seas, and skies that change every moment. Our goal is to get you to the right place at the right time, so some activities and locations may be adapted on a day-to-day basis depending on the light, weather, and rhythm of the island.

At Abora Expeditions, we believe in traveling with purpose and with nature, not against it. We read the territory in real time and map out the best possible route at any given moment to ensure a safe, authentic, and deeply connected experience.

We invite you to explore and embrace the unexpected as part of the magic of travel, guided by our experts. Because, for us, every change is an opportunity to see, feel, understand, and immortalize the island.

The price includes

- Transportation throughout the expedition in the Biosphere Reserve.

- Charming accommodation, integrated into the landscape and committed to the environment and the local community.

- Breakfast and lunch or dinner made with local products and traditional cuisine.

- Expert guides in La Palma.

- Travel Commitment Contribution (€10/person/day), intended to offset the carbon footprint and directly support conservation/land stewardship projects on the island of La Palma.

- Be part of the Abora project and its guarantee of traveling with commitment, respect for the land, and a commitment to tourism for future generations.

- Insurance.
